Yes, you can experience a sudden or gradual loss of smell (anosmia) or taste (ageusia) when acute inflammation, physical obstructions, or viral pathogens disrupt the specialized sensory receptors in your nasal cavity and oral tissues. Because your perception of flavor relies heavily on airborne aromas reaching your olfactory nerves, any condition that swells the nasal lining or alters nerve signaling will cause food to taste completely bland, metallic, or muted.

However, while temporary sensory loss is a known consequence of standard seasonal bugs, a prolonged or unexplained inability to smell and taste can indicate chronic structural blocks or neurological changes that require professional intervention. Immediate Walk-In Medical Conditions Treated Today

Local walk-in facilities are fully equipped to evaluate and treat a diverse range of immediate health concerns affecting your olfactory and gustatory systems:

  • Viral Upper Respiratory Infections: Rapid evaluation and symptom management for COVID-19, influenza, and the common cold, which cause direct cellular inflammation and nerve dampening.

  • Acute and Chronic Sinusitis: Targeted clinical care to reduce deep bacterial or viral sinus infections that block airflow from reaching upper nasal scent receptors.

  • Allergic Rhinitis (Severe Allergies): Fast relief from intense environmental triggers and hay fever that cause chronic mucosal swelling and continuous congestion.

  • Intranasal Obstructions: Initial screening for physical barriers within the nasal passages, including noncancerous nasal polyps or a significantly deviated septum.
